In 1989, Ken Follett astonished the literary world with The Pillars of the Earth, a sweeping epic novel set in twelfth -century. England that centered on the building of a cathedral and on the men, women, and children´s whose lives it changed forever, Critics were overwhelmed -"it will hold you, fascinate you, surround you" (Chicago Tribute) - and readers ever since have hoped for a sequel. At last, it is here... Two centuries after the townspeople of Kings-bridge finished building their exquisite Gothic cathedral, four children slip into the forest and witness a killing -an event that will braid their lives together by ambition, love, greed, and revenge.
